St Anne's CofE Primary School
208 St Ann's Hill, Wandsworth, London SW18 2RU
St Anne's CofE Primary School is a Church of England primary school maintained by the local authority (Wandsworth). It has about 160 boys and girls aged between 3 and 11. In February 2023 the school was rated ‘Good’ by Ofsted.
Particular strengths include Admissions, Progress, Attainment and Disadvantaged pupils. Relative weaknesses include Representation and Environment.

Admissions: Excellent. The occupancy rate is very low.
Progress: Excellent. Progress in maths is above average, in reading it is excellent and in writing it is excellent. (This takes into account pupils' prior performance. For actual grades, see Attainment.)
Attainment: Excellent. Maths, reading and GPS (grammar, punctuation and spelling) attainment are all above average. (This doesn't take into account pupils' prior performance. For that, see Progress.)
Disadvantaged pupils: Above average. Progress in maths is about average. Progress in reading is above average. Progress in writing is excellent.
Attendance: Above average. Pupil absence rates and the incidence of persistent absence are both quite low.
Finances: About average. The school budget has been roughly in balance
Environment: Below average. Air pollution, traffic accidents and crime are all quite high.
Representation: Out of balance. The socio-economic mix is slightly out of balance with the local community, while ethnic representation is out of balance with the local community. Show details
